As a Programmes and Performance Coordinator in our Service Improvement department you will:
1. Effectively provide a support framework for the department programmes and wider service projects
2. Liaise with key stakeholders to ensure engagement to maximise efficiency and effectiveness
3. Maintain and develop business case management within the principles of good governance and in line with principles of PRM13
4. Analyse and evaluate complex data to provide performance data and management information as required to support performance reporting
What makes you our ideal Programmes and Performance Coordinator?
5. Knowledge and relevant working experience in programme and project management at this level, working with managers across all levels of the organisation to influence continuous improvement
6. Experience of using Microsoft products and systems such as MS365, SharePoint and Power platforms
7. Sound knowledge of good governance with regards to data and information management
8. Experience of analysing complex data to develop reports and recommendations for subsequent managerial action
